Mysql服务的安装

2023-10-27

本文适用于新手/小白 , 而且专业术语不到位。本文内容可能无法解决教程外其他问题,望多包涵

多图警告

此教程适用于windows系统

1d9a33014b1444aa844c9e6ce49010d4.png

 

教程流程↑↑

 

 


安装时

1、下载安装包

     这个是下载链接

MySQLhttps://www.mysql.com/

 

 打开界面后单击【DOWNLOADS】(下载)

 5b173412327a410b8a1925078a49b604.png

 

 然后在此页面下划,找到这行链接

1e5a56bece1b4d078d7cb2010ef92025.png

 

点击进入后,在这两个链接里选择下载(效果相同)

fef6876082af4ee58dce59d397583a0a.png

 

/*  这里多说几句

    *不论选哪个,挑界面里最大的文件下载(避免繁琐操作)

    *Mysql常见版本是 5.7+ 或者是 8.0+,特别说明,没有6.+和7.+版本的Mysql服务。版本是直接从  5.7+  跳到  8.0+ 的

*/

这里笔者选择的是下面的,点击【Download】即可下载。如果想要安装5.7+版本的单击这里

be22f2a14207442189e2a906512e0851.png

出现这个界面后,点击这里直接下载

6b561e7f12684f6fac9f3a3490b69551.png

 

 2、安装MySQL

下载好安装包后双击打开,跳出这个界面,选择这个,然后【next】进入下一步

36f4df2c876e411083b8c8336132db3b.png

 

ps:若这步卡了请耐心等待

 

7bd878d6cc6f4d2ea3c9448decabeeab.png

 

 

如图选择对应的安装项,单击选择后,再点击这个向右的箭头,表示添加安装

// 不要在下面打钩!!

378734ce4e054b179a925364d70e1d2b.png

 

 

如果安装的是 5.7+ 版本且操作系统是64x的,请选择x64

 

1fa2af236a9a4f36b98409769cd718d4.png

 

如果想要把安装位置和文件路径指定,点击这里

//要先点击右边框里的安装条目才会出现图里的小字

b74eb5e427cd4a13a1174fbb8287da42.png

 

 

点击这个 【Advanced Options 】    ,选择指定位置 ,然后【ok】或者【yes】确认

067a478d20ad4450a936ad5b154538f7.png

 

 

然后【ok】或者【yes】确认,再【next】进入下一步

de131d087fe443739751ceefe10b16f3.png

 

 

若出现这个界面,任【yes】确定

c2d9d11efdfd414fa17b4979c09b7fa1.png

 

点击确认安装

 

cf44ce15d0c54813b8b6bc41a3a9d8ec.png

 

 之后一直选择【next】,直到,这里按照图(推)里(荐)的信息选择,然后【next】

 

/*  这里多说几句

    这里若是简单教学使用,按系统推荐的即可,不需要修改选项,不代表不能修改,这里不作深入教程

*/

55d6009535ab43188cbbe822a4bfa387.png

 

出现这个界面后选择第二个选项

 

/*

    这里建议是自己的电脑或用于教学时,选择第二项,否则在使用图形化管理mysql软件时会出现错误。若是其他用途请选第一项

   8.0 + 版本才会有这个界面,5.7 + 是没有这个界面的

*/

1b617b9722764d5bbd1f3a7553a4c73d.png

 

 

然后设置自己的密码并输入确认密码(第二次输入),这里mysql默认把账户名定为  root  ,不需要用户自己输入。然后【next】进入下一步

 

// 注意记住自己的密码,两次输入要一致,否则不能进入下一步

231405094a894ad496d87dc353c48a6f.png

 

这里保持默认,【next】进入下一步 (这里是在询问:是否开机自己启动和服务的名字)

// 取名时请用英文和英文空格,否则可能发生错误

 

3c5f6a61f7ac42fda2ddb66dd9413020.png

 

 若出现这个界面,建议选择no  ,当人,随个人喜好(询问用户:有新版本的mysql时要不要推荐安装)

 

087879791c63472c883025f311c177f4.png

 

 

然后【Execute】安装,这里可能需要一点时间,请耐心等待

 

f88ad6c2ea5c4d7099755bbb94c5f123.png

 

当这里的勾全部打上时说明安装正确

 

892a59b6b8d048d88008ad5399718f04.png

 

然后【Finish】,【next】,【Finish】,完成安装

// 完成安装后,安装界面自动退出

 

设置环境变量

先打开高级系统设置

// 右键单击【此电脑】- 【属性】-【高级系统设置】

8850d643f3174fd196889cec03eede9d.png

 双击这个【Path】

3b1b49babe2040c9b865235de9fda869.png

 

然后新建

76b151554f64420abea70cca4a1096dc.png

 

 这里要填充的内容是安装mysql时的文件目录下的【bin】

ee713b744fc24830b85c56277a61c4cc.png

 

 // 点击条框内中空白处即可复制,其路径因人而异

把它粘贴到这里,然后把它【上移】到正数第一的位置

0680cf95e8174d1782e36965ac7961cb.png

然后一直【确定】,直到界面自动消失

 

测试安装结果

键盘上同时按  win 和 r 键,打开【运行】

 

ba3f06a037bc4c299c1012cbeb58d62c.png

 

输入  cmd  ,然后单击确定,打开这个57

本文内容由网友自发贡献,版权归原作者所有,本站不承担相应法律责任。如您发现有涉嫌抄袭侵权的内容,请联系:hwhale#tublm.com(使用前将#替换为@)

Mysql服务的安装 的相关文章

  • 使用 MySQL 的 CURDATE() 或 PHP 的 date() 更快?

    使用mysql查询是不是更快 SELECT CURDATE as today 或 PHP 语句 curdate date Y m d 同样的答案是否适用于使用date VS MySQL 的NOW and CURTIME 如果您只是执行查询以
  • 用于全文搜索和 2 亿多条记录的数据库

    我即将创建一个包含至少 2 亿个条目的庞大数据库 数据库需要可使用全文进行搜索 并且速度应该很快 我的数据库从许多不同的数据源获取数据 我需要定期导入新的或更新的数据 将我的所有数据存储在像 mysql 这样的关系数据库中 然后创建一个 n
  • MySQL通过UPDATE/DELETE合并重复数据记录

    我有一个看起来像这样的表 mysql gt SELECT FROM Colors ID USERNAME RED GREEN YELLOW BLUE ORANGE PURPLE 1 joe 1 null 1 null null null 2
  • 条件对列表的 In 子句

    有一个表 我需要通过在配对值列表中应用和条件来获取分页记录 下面是解释 假设我有一堂课Billoflading其中有各个领域 表中两个重要字段是 tenant billtype 我有一个包含值的对列表 tenant1 billtype1 t
  • MySQL - 查找接近的匹配项

    MySQL 有没有办法在文本字段中找到紧密匹配的内容 说找到 email protected cdn cgi l email protection当搜索时 email protected cdn cgi l email protection
  • Mysql 将 --secure-file-priv 选项设置为 NULL

    我在 Ubuntu 中运行 MySQL 我在运行特定的查询集时收到此错误 MySQL 服务器正在使用 secure file priv 选项运行 因此无法执行此语句 当我这样做的时候SELECT secure file priv 在我的 m
  • 内连接 3 个表

    我正在使用 PHP 和 PDO 我需要重新收集连接 3 个表的信息 photos albums 相册照片 该表具有以下结构 photos photo id int path varchar nick varchar date timesta
  • MySQL 两种日期格式之间的转换

    用户将以这种格式输入日期 2017 年 2 月 17 日 存储在 mysql 数据库中的日期格式如下 2015 02 17 00 00 00 我想做的是 SELECT FROM insurance where DATE FORMAT in
  • 批处理文件并与数据库比较

    目前我正在开发一个 Spring Boot 应用程序 该应用程序定期尝试处理包含用户数据的文件 其中每行都包含userId and departamentId隔开 例如123534 13 该文件将包含数百万条记录 我的要求是以这样的方式将此
  • sql直接获取表行数的方法

    stackoverflow 的朋友们大家好 我的例行程序中有一个我认为不必要的步骤 假设您想从图库中获取所有图像 并限制每页一定数量的图像 db PDO object start pagenum x images per page limi
  • 控制数据是否存在于数组中

    我在mysql中有两个不同的表 我正在使用curl从json文件中获取数据 我的第一个表名称是 tblclients 该表存储客户端数据 我的第二个表名称是 tblcustomfieldsvalues 该表使用 tblclients 表的
  • parent_id 是外键(自引用)并且为 null?

    浏览 Bill Karwin 的书 SQL Antipatterns 第 3 章 Naive Trees 邻接表 父子关系 有一个注释表的示例 CREATE TABLE Comments comment id SERIAL PRIMARY
  • Mysql加密/存储敏感数据,

    我的 PHP 网站有以下内容 启用 SSL 饼干 session set cookie params cookieParams lifetime cookieParams path cookieParams domain secure ht
  • 如何编写一个 SQL 查询来计算每月和每年的行数?

    有谁知道如何查询 vbulletin 数据库来生成每月 每年注册数量的报告 以获得如下结果 MM YYYY Count 01 2001 10 02 2001 12 感谢下面的这些答案 我的最终版本有效如下 SELECT COUNT as R
  • 考虑到我的图像链接存储在MySQL数据库中,如何通过php显示存储在文件夹中的图像

    作为良好的做法 我只将图像链接存储在数据库中 问题是 我应该如何存储图像的链接 假设它在 c 上 c image jpg 我应该使用哪段 PHP 代码来显示该图像 我只显示路径 我该怎么做才能显示图像 我可以用这个吗 query SELEC
  • 哪些mysql设置影响LOAD DATA INFILE的速度?

    让我来介绍一下情况 我们尝试将适量的行数 大约每天 10 20M 插入到宽度适中的 MyISAM 表中 Field Type Null Key Default Extra blah1 varchar 255 NO PRI blah2 var
  • 使用 libpqxx 批量存储数据或如何在 libpqxx 中使用 COPY 语句

    要在 PostgreSQL 中插入批量数据 填充数据库 最快的方法是使用 COPY Source https stackoverflow com questions 758945 whats the fastest way to do a
  • Gmail 搜索怎么这么快?

    搜索这么多字符的最有效方法是什么 你怎么认为 假设网站是用 PHP 和 MySQL 构建的 我应该学习什么才能尽可能有效地构建它 有什么我应该学习的算法吗 文本索引算法 https stackoverflow com questions 4
  • JPA:如何将字符串持久保存到数据库字段中,输入 MYSQL Text

    需求是用户可以写文章 所以我选择typeText为了contentmysql数据库内的字段 我怎样才能转换Java String into MySQL Text 干得好Jim Tough Entity public class Articl
  • 在Spring-Boot中,我们如何在同一个项目中连接两个数据库(Mysql数据库和MongoDB)?

    我正在尝试创建一个 Spring Boot 项目 其中我有一个要求 我想连接到不同的数据库 MySql 和 MongoDB 我是否需要做一些特殊的事情来连接到这两个数据库 或者 spring boot 会自动计算出自己连接到这两个数据库 我

随机推荐

  • 傻白入门芯片设计,史上最最最全DRAM介绍(十二)

    目录 1 DRAM单元阵列 1 1 DRAM基本单元 1 2 cell阵列 1 3 cell阵列的读取 1 4 DRAM刷新 2 DRAM芯片的读写 2 1 必须的周围逻辑 2 2 完整的读过程 重点 2 3 完整的写过程 2 4 时间消耗
  • javascript 数组一键乱序

    方法1 给数组原生的sort方法传入一个函数 此函数随机返回1或 1 达到随机排列数组元素的目的 const arr1 1 2 3 4 5 6 7 8 9 1 2 3 4 5 6 7 8 9 const shuffleArray arr g
  • MAC机后端开发必备

    开篇 相信很多日常使用 MAC 进行软件开发的同学会有一种感受 在换 MAC 机的时候 拿到的都是一些裸系统 有一些常用必备的软件需要重新来安装一遍 我也遇到几次这样的问题 发现每次配置开发环境时都要安装这么几个方便好用的工具 在这总结一下
  • 获取url中的参数

    获取url 后的参数 location对象 含有当前URL的信息 属性 href 整个URL字符串 protocol 含有URL第一部分的字符串 如http host 包含有URL中主机名 端口号部分的字符串 如 www cenpok ne
  • 使用openssl_encrypt方法替代mcrypt_encrypt做AES加密

    mcrypt encrypt在php7 1中已被废弃 需要使用openssl encrypt代替 mdecrypt generic版 public function encrypt cbc str iv encryptKey module
  • java8中stream()的使用案例

    Test public void t1 List
  • VS2008中的 fatal error C1902: 程序数据库管理器不匹配

    因为VC Bin 下没有 msobj80 dll mspdb80 dll mspdbcore dll mspdbsrv exe 这四个文件 解决的方法 1 gt 直接从Common7 IDE 下复制这四个文件到VC Bin 下即可解决 2
  • Android-四大应用组件之Activity

    一 理论概述 Activity的理解 二 Intent和IntentFilter的理解 显示意图 当目标组件是当前应用的 则用显示意图 隐式意图 当目标组件是其他应用的 则用隐式意图 三 相关API 四 Activity的启动流程 通过Ac
  • 网络安全工具——Wireshark抓包工具

    文章目录 一 Wireshark抓包介绍 1 WireShark简介 2 WireShark的应用 3 WireShark抓数据包技巧 二 Wireshark抓包入门操作 1 常见协议包 2 查看本机要抓包的网络 3 混杂模式介绍 4 如何
  • stratascratch刷题1 salaries difference && Finding Updated Records

    1 解题 select select max salary from db employee join db dept on db employee department id db dept id where department mar
  • 接口测试的基础(网络传输知识与协议篇)

    接口测试的基础 测试人员对于接口测试的理解总是停留在工具使用层面 很多情况下 测试人员会花很大的 代价去学习一个工具 而测试工具本身的局限性 又导致测试人员陷入想直接用现成的测试框架 却又无法进行扩展的僵局 最后由于项目的特殊性等客观因素
  • ping命令中ICMP协议包的分析

    UDP收发以及所需要的ARP协议已经全部实现 接下来让咱们的协议栈支持ping 俗称能ping通 ping的请求和发送实际是ICMP协议的一个子集 ICMP可以参考ICMP数据包结构 Focus 新浪博客 在IP头中ICMP协议的标识是01
  • springboot项目读取 resource下面的json文件,并且解析

    在Spring Boot项目中 如果要读取src main resources目录下的JSON文件 可以使用ResourceLoader来加载文件 并使用Jackson库将JSON文件解析成Java对象 以下是一个简单的示例代码 impor
  • Type-C协议简介(CC检测原理)

    1 简介 越来越多的手机开始采用Type C作为充电和通信端口 Type C连接器实物和PIN定义如下图 目录 1 简介 Type C连接器中有两个管脚CC1和CC2 他们用于识别连接器的插入方向 以及不同的插入设备 本文介绍CC的基本识别
  • Bootrom概述

    1 Bootrom 是指on chip bootrom 在CPU芯片内部 内嵌有小的boot程序 bootloader 类似于PC机主板上的BIOS的存储区域 2 Bootloader怎么得到 如果对开发板有些改动 还能使用开发板的boot
  • solidity学习过程---msg

    solidity 5 0 remix测试 个人学习 欢迎指正 msg 研究了好一会 感觉还是有点困惑 msg sender 当前合约的调用者 1 部署合约的地址 2 调用该合约的地址 msg value 随消息发送的 wei 的数量 其实并
  • 【Spark NLP】第 15 章:聊天机器人

    大家好 我是Sonhhxg 柒 希望你看完之后 能对你有所帮助 不足请指正 共同学习交流 个人主页 Sonhhxg 柒的博客 CSDN博客 欢迎各位 点赞 收藏 留言 系列专栏 机器学习 ML 自然语言处理 NLP 深度学习 DL fore
  • sonarQube详细安装

    目录 安装前提 将zip包scp到服务器 解压sonar的zip包 修改配置 创建用户sonar 将sonar目录授权给sonar用户 执行命令 查看日志 遇到的问题 今天学习了一下sonar 想看看代码质量检查工具的使用 安装前提 需要j
  • python笔记9--socket初步使用

    python笔记9 socket初步使用 1 介绍 2 源码案例 2 1 tcp c s 案例 2 2 udp c s 案例 3 说明 最近需要写个c s小应用 因此看了下socket编程 把学习的笔记贴在此处以便于后续查阅 1 介绍 本文
  • Mysql服务的安装

    本文适用于新手 小白 而且专业术语不到位 本文内容可能无法解决教程外其他问题 望多包涵 多图警告 此教程适用于windows系统 教程流程 安装时 1 下载安装包 这个是下载链接 MySQLhttps www mysql com 打开界面后